The distance between Fort Lauderdale airport and the cruise port is approximately 5 miles, or about a 15-minute drive, depending on traffic conditions. While this may seem like a short distance, it's important to factor in potential traffic delays and the time it takes to collect your luggage and go through customs at the airport. To ensure a stress-free journey, it's recommended to allow yourself at least 2 hours between your flight arrival time and your cruise departure time.

Understanding the Distance

The distance between Fort Lauderdale airport and the cruise port is relatively short, but there are a few factors to consider when planning your journey. First, it's important to account for traffic conditions, as this can greatly impact travel time. If possible, try to avoid peak travel times, such as rush hour, to minimize the chances of getting stuck in traffic.

Additionally, it's a good idea to familiarize yourself with the layout of the airport and the cruise port before you arrive. Knowing where you need to go and how to get there can save you valuable time and reduce stress. Many cruise lines offer transportation services from the airport to the cruise port, so be sure to check if this is an option for you.

Going the Extra Mile: Exploring the Topic Further

For those who want to delve deeper into the topic of how far is the cruise port from Fort Lauderdale airport, it's worth considering the various transportation options available. From taxis and ride-sharing services to private car services and shuttle buses, there are a variety of options to suit different preferences and budgets.

Additionally, it's worth noting that Fort Lauderdale is not the only cruise port in the area. Miami is another popular departure point for cruises, and it's located about 30 miles south of Fort Lauderdale. If you're flying into Fort Lauderdale but departing from Miami, it's important to factor in the additional travel time and consider transportation options that can accommodate this longer distance.
